    IGP DISU DEPLOYS AIG ZONE 4 TO PLATEAU, ASSESSES BIN’PER ATTACK, REINFORCES SECURITY

    Malam Mujitaba RamalanBy Malam Mujitaba RamalanAugust 21, 20262 Mins Read
    FB IMG 1787341171486
    FB IMG 1787341171486

    The Inspector-General of Police, IGP Olatunji Rilwan Disu, psc(+), NPM, represented by the Assistant Inspector-General of Police in charge of Zone 4, Makurdi, AIG Dankombo F. Morris, psc(+), conducted an on-the-spot assessment of Bin’per Community, Mangu Local Government Area of Plateau State, following the recent attack which claimed the lives of about 24 residents, injured several others and destroyed property.

    A statement signed by CSP Ani Iniedu, Force Public Relations Officer,Force Headquarters, Abuja said AIG Morris, accompanied by the Commissioner of Police, Plateau State Command, CP Ayoade Faniyan, and other senior Police officers, assessed the security situation in the community and reviewed measures being implemented to strengthen security and prevent further attacks.

    Addressing the affected residents, the AIG conveyed the IGP’s deep concern over the incident and condemned the attack as barbaric and unacceptable. He expressed sympathy to the families of those killed and assured the community of the Force’s commitment to ensuring that the perpetrators of the crime are apprehended.

    He disclosed that additional personnel and operational assets had been deployed to strengthen security in the affected area, while efforts were being intensified to restore confidence and enable residents to safely return to their homes and livelihoods.

    During the visit, AIG Morris paid a courtesy call on the Executive Governor of Plateau State, Barr. Caleb Mutfwang, where he conveyed the condolences of the Inspector-General of Police, IGP Olatunji Rilwan Disu, psc(+), NPM, to the Government and people of the State over the unfortunate incident. In his response, the Governor expressed concern over the attack and reaffirmed the State Government’s support for ongoing security efforts to apprehend the perpetrators, prevent further attacks and restore lasting peace in the affected communities.

    The Nigeria Police Force remains committed to working with the Plateau State Government, other security agencies and affected communities to strengthen security, prevent further violence and ensure the safety of residents across the State.
